Understanding Family Communication Challenges

Before diving into how family counselling can help, it’s important to understand the common communication issues that many families face. Effective communication involves not only speaking clearly but also listening with empathy and understanding. Below are some common challenges that families encounter:

  • Misunderstanding emotions: Family members may fail to express their feelings clearly, leading to misinterpretation.
  • Lack of active listening: Often, family members may not be fully engaged in conversations, which results in feelings of being unheard or ignored.
  • Poor conflict resolution: When disagreements arise, some families struggle to resolve them in a productive manner, leading to unresolved tension.
  • Generational gaps: Different generations within a family may have contrasting communication styles, causing misunderstandings and frustration.
  • Stress and external factors: Life events such as work stress, financial problems, or personal issues can create communication barriers between family members.

Understanding these challenges is the first step toward improving communication. Now, let’s look at how family counselling can help address these issues and promote healthier communication patterns within your family.

How Family Counselling Can Enhance Communication

1. Promotes Active Listening

In many families, communication becomes one-sided or unbalanced, with some members dominating conversations while others struggle to get their point across. One of the primary goals of family counselling is to help family members practice active listening. Active listening involves truly hearing and understanding what the other person is saying, without interrupting or jumping to conclusions.

In counselling sessions, the therapist may guide the family on how to listen with empathy and respond thoughtfully. This approach fosters better understanding and ensures that each family member feels heard and respected.

2. Teaches Healthy Conflict Resolution

Conflicts are a natural part of family life, but how they are handled can determine whether they strengthen or weaken family bonds. Family counselling provides families with the tools and techniques to handle disagreements constructively. Instead of shouting, blaming, or avoiding tough conversations, family members can learn to approach conflicts calmly and with respect.

Therapists often introduce conflict resolution strategies such as:

  • “I” statements: Encouraging family members to express their feelings using “I” statements instead of blaming others.
  • Time-outs: Taking a break to cool down before continuing a discussion.
  • Compromise and negotiation: Finding middle ground where all parties feel heard and valued.

By learning these strategies, families can resolve conflicts in a way that strengthens their relationships, rather than causing emotional wounds.

3. Encourages Open and Honest Communication

Sometimes, family members may feel reluctant to share their true feelings due to fear of judgment or rejection. Family counselling provides a safe and supportive space where family members can express themselves openly without fear of being criticized. The therapist ensures that each person has the opportunity to speak, and that their thoughts and feelings are validated.

This safe space allows families to address issues that may have been avoided or ignored for years. Honest conversations can lead to greater understanding and a sense of emotional closeness among family members.

4. Helps Bridge Generational Gaps

One common issue in family communication is the difference in communication styles across generations. Parents and children, or even grandparents and grandchildren, may speak different “languages” when it comes to communication. These generational gaps can create misunderstandings, frustration, and tension.

Family counselling can help bridge these gaps by promoting mutual understanding. A therapist may work with the family to:

  • Identify differences in communication styles.
  • Encourage empathy and respect for each other’s viewpoints.
  • Find common ground that allows family members to relate to one another more effectively.

5. Improves Emotional Awareness and Expression

In many families, emotions are either not expressed or are expressed in unhealthy ways. For instance, a family member may bottle up their emotions, leading to resentment, or they may react impulsively in moments of anger, causing unnecessary drama.

Through family counselling, families can learn how to identify and express their emotions in a healthy manner. This might include recognizing the signs of stress, frustration, or sadness, and communicating those emotions before they escalate. Families can also learn techniques to manage their emotions, which helps to prevent emotional outbursts.

Practical Tips for Enhancing Family Communication

While family counselling can provide expert guidance, there are also practical steps that families can take on their own to improve communication. Here are some simple yet effective tips:

  • Have regular family meetings: Set aside time each week or month for open discussions about how things are going. This helps everyone stay on the same page.
  • Use technology to connect: If family members are spread out geographically, use video calls, texts, or messaging apps to stay connected and communicate regularly.
  • Practice empathy: Make an effort to understand things from the other person’s perspective. This fosters mutual respect and understanding.
  • Establish ground rules: Agree on communication rules, such as not interrupting and refraining from yelling, to ensure respectful conversations.
  • Create family rituals: Regularly doing activities together, like family dinners or game nights, can improve connection and facilitate more natural communication.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. What are the main benefits of family counselling?

Family counselling improves communication, enhances relationships, helps resolve conflicts, and promotes emotional well-being for all family members.

2. How long does family counselling take?

The duration of family counselling varies depending on the issues being addressed and the family’s goals. Some families may need only a few sessions, while others may benefit from ongoing support.

3. Can family counselling help with children’s behavior issues?

Yes, family counselling can provide parents with strategies for managing children’s behavior, improving parent-child communication, and fostering a positive family environment.

4. What if we have communication problems with one family member?

Even if only one family member is struggling with communication, family counselling can still help. It can provide a safe space to discuss concerns and work on improving communication with that person.

5. Is family counselling only for severe problems?

No, family counselling is beneficial for families experiencing minor communication issues, as well as for those dealing with more serious problems like conflict or mental health concerns.
